Surviving the Crapshoot Without Losing Your Shirt

If you’re the sort of bloke who enjoys the grind rather than chasing rainbows, there are a few hard‑won tactics to keep the $10 no deposit bonus from turning into a financial black hole.

First, treat the bonus as a test drive, not a payday. Use it to explore the casino’s UI, see how the withdrawal process works, and gauge the support response. If you can’t even get a $5 cash‑out in a week, the platform probably isn’t worth your time.

Second, pick games with low variance and high RTP. Starburst, while visually garish, offers a decent RTP around 96.1%, making it a safer playground for a tiny bankroll. Avoid the flashy, high‑variance titles if your goal is simply to clear the wagering requirement without burning through the bonus.

Third, keep a strict ledger. Jot down every bet, win, and the remaining wagering balance. The moment you notice the requirement creeping upwards after each win, you’ll understand why the “free” money feels so heavy.
